Skip to content

DoC: Darker 4PDA by dark

Screenshot of DoC: Darker 4PDA

Details

Authordark

LicenseCC BY-NC

Category4pda

Created

Updated

Size72 kB

Statistics

Learn how we calculate statistics in the FAQ.

Failed to fetch stats.

Description

Тёмное оформление для форума 4pda.(ru|to).
По умолчанию цвет основных элементов — белый, для изменения цвета под свой вкус вам надо дополнительно поставить DoC: Darker 4PDA - Color overrides.
Вы, конечно, можете изменить цвета в этом файле стилей, однако в данном случае будут проблемы с обновлениями, когда/если они выйдут, потому и было решено разделить стили, чтобы каждый пользователь мог настроить цветовую гамму под себя, не потеряв эти настройки при обновлении базового стиля.

Notes

2021-12-19
~ исправлена панель редактора при быстром редактировании сообщения
~ исправлен цвет перманентной ссылки на сообщение

2021-10-26

  • добавлен домен 4pda.to
    ~ размер шрифта теперь влияет на гораздо большее количество элементов
  • добавлена возможность изменять цвет текста у элементов с акцентированным фоном
    ~ много разных изменений/исправлений, исправлены старые недочёты, добавлены новые

2019-11-19
~ исправлен QMS под новую структуру
~ оформлены кнопки рейтинга постов
~ кучка небольших исправлений везде подряд

2019-02-13
~ исправлена страница с упоминаниями и поиск пользователей

2019-02-12
~ исправлена страница 404 и настройки форума
~ небольшие исправления на странице истории репутации

2019-01-31
~ исправления читабельности в попапе скачивания
~ исправление кнопки поиска в шапке
~ оформлена загрузка файлов

2018-11-18
~ исправлен логотип в шапке

2018-11-06
~ дооформлено редактирование профиля

  • оформлено объявление под шапкой
    ~ небольшие исправления

2018-10-24
~ Исправлено оформление кнопок „В FAQ“, „Быстрый ответ“, „Ответить“, „Новая тема“, „Тема закрыта“
~ Исправлены цвета и размеры текста (привет любителям нечитаемых оффтопов)

  • Отключено оформление чекбоксов и радиокнопок
  • Оформлена страница пользователя

2018-10-20
~ Исправлено оформление кнопок „Наверх“, „Жалоба“, „Имя“ и „Цитировать“

Source code

Source code has over 10K characters, so we truncated it. You can inspect the full source code on install link.
/* ==UserStyle==
@name           DoC: Darker 4PDA
@namespace      https://darklab.ru
@author         Dark Preacher <dark@darklab.ru> (https://darklab.ru)
@version        1.0.2
@license        CC-BY-NC-4.0
==/UserStyle== */
@-moz-document regexp("https?://4pda.(ru|to)/forum/.*") {
:root{--tran:all .3s ease-in-out;--fz-d:var(--fz,16px);--fg-h-d:var(--fg-h,0);--fg-s-d:var(--fg-s,0%);--fg-l-d:var(--fg-l,95%);--bg-h-d:var(--bg-h,0);--bg-s-d:var(--bg-s,0%);--bg-l-d:var(--bg-l,5%);--accent-h-d:var(--accent-h,0);--accent-s-d:var(--accent-s,0%);--accent-l-d:var(--accent-l,75%);--c-red-h:11;--c-red-s:100%;--c-red-l:61%;--c-green-h:76;--c-green-s:50%;--c-green-l:48%;--fg-accent-d:var(--fg-accent,var(--bg));--bg:hsl(var(--bg-h-d),var(--bg-s-d),var(--bg-l-d));--fg:hsl(var(--fg-h-d),var(--fg-s-d),var(--fg-l-d));--fg-dim:hsl(var(--fg-h-d),var(--fg-s-d),calc(var(--fg-l-d) * .5));--accent:hsl(var(--accent-h-d),var(--accent-s-d),var(--accent-l-d));--accent-hover:hsl(var(--accent-h-d),var(--accent-s-d),calc(var(--accent-l-d) * 1.5));--accent-dim:hsl(var(--accent-h-d),var(--accent-s-d),calc(var(--accent-l-d) * .75));--c-red:hsl(var(--c-red-h),var(--c-red-s),var(--c-red-l));--c-green:hsl(var(--c-green-h),var(--c-green-s),var(--c-green-l));scrollbar-color:var(--accent-v10) var(--bg);scrollbar-width:thin}html{box-sizing:border-box;height:100%;fill:inherit;stroke:inherit}body,html{position:relative}body{background:var(--bg);color:var(--fg);font-size:var(--fz-d)}a{line-height:unset!important}a,a:visited{color:var(--accent)!important;transition:var(--tran)}a:active,a:hover{color:var(--accent-hover)!important}.btn,.btn.blue,.button,.forum-attach-files-buttons .attach-btn,.forum-attach-form .attach-btn,.g-btn.blue,.input-ok,.input-ok-content,.zbtn,.zbtn-default{border:0;border-radius:2px;background:var(--accent);box-shadow:unset;color:var(--fg-accent-d)!important;transition:var(--tran)}.btn.blue:active,.btn.blue:focus,.btn.blue:hover,.btn:active,.btn:focus,.btn:hover,.button:active,.button:focus,.button:hover,.forum-attach-files-buttons .attach-btn:active,.forum-attach-files-buttons .attach-btn:focus,.forum-attach-files-buttons .attach-btn:hover,.forum-attach-form .attach-btn:active,.forum-attach-form .attach-btn:focus,.forum-attach-form .attach-btn:hover,.g-btn.blue:active,.g-btn.blue:focus,.g-btn.blue:hover,.input-ok-content:active,.input-ok-content:focus,.input-ok-content:hover,.input-ok:active,.input-ok:focus,.input-ok:hover,.zbtn-default:active,.zbtn-default:focus,.zbtn-default:hover,.zbtn:active,.zbtn:focus,.zbtn:hover{background:var(--accent-hover);color:var(--fg-accent-d)!important}.btn.blue[disabled],.btn[disabled],.button[disabled],.forum-attach-files-buttons .attach-btn[disabled],.forum-attach-form .attach-btn[disabled],.g-btn.blue[disabled],.input-ok-content[disabled],.input-ok[disabled],.zbtn-default[disabled],.zbtn[disabled]{background:var(--accent-dim);color:var(--fg-accent-d)}.btn-link{box-shadow:unset;color:var(--accent)!important;transition:var(--tran)}.btn-link:active,.btn-link:hover{color:var(--accent-hover)!important}.g-btn.nopad{padding-right:4px;padding-left:4px}.g-btn.red{background:var(--c-red)!important}.g-btn.green,.g-btn.red{color:var(--fg-accent-d)!important}.g-btn.green{background:var(--c-green)!important}.semodfuncpan a{height:unset}.layout-internal{background-color:transparent}.content{background:var(--bg);color:var(--fg)}.ed-wrap td{border:0!important}.ed-wrap .ed-panel,.ed-wrap .ed-vtoggle-down,.ed-wrap .ed-vtoggle-hover,.ed-wrap .ed-vtoggle-normal{background-color:var(--accent);color:var(--bg)}.ed-wrap .ed-panel-title{color:var(--bg)}.ed-wrap .ed-p-textarea{background-color:transparent;padding:0}.ed-wrap .ed-textarea{background:var(--bg);padding:6px 12px;color:var(--fg)}.ed-wrap .ed-color-normal{transition:var(--tran);border-color:var(--accent)}.ed-wrap .ed-color-hover{transition:var(--tran);border-color:var(--bg)}.ed-wrap div.ed-bbcode-down,.ed-wrap div.ed-bbcode-hover,.ed-wrap div.ed-bbcode-normal{transition:var(--tran);color:var(--bg)}.ed-wrap div.ed-bbcode-down,.ed-wrap div.ed-bbcode-hover{background-color:var(--bg);color:var(--accent)}#ed-0_ap>table,#ed--1_ap>table{border:0!important}.qr-maintitle{display:none}.dipt{background-color:transparent;color:var(--fg)}.dipt:after{box-shadow:inset 0 1px 0 0 var(--accent-dim)}.dipt .dfrml{box-shadow:unset}.dipt .dfrml+.dfrmr,.dipt .dfrmrbrd{box-shadow:-1px 0 0 0 var(--accent-dim)}.forum-attach-form .forum-attach-file-border{border-color:var(--accent-dim);background-color:hsl(var(--bg-h-d),var(--bg-s-d),calc(var(--bg-l-d) * 2))}.forum-attach-form .view-preview{background:transparent}.forum-attach-form .progress{background-color:hsl(var(--bg-h-d),var(--bg-s-d),calc(var(--bg-l-d) * 4))}.forum-attach-form .progress-bar{background-color:var(--accent)}.row1 div.postcolor{background-color:var(--bg)!important}.postcolor .ed-wrap .ed-panel,.postcolor .ed-wrap .ed-panel td{background-color:var(--accent)!important}img[src$="folder_editor_buttons/area_minus.png"],img[src$="folder_editor_buttons/area_plus.png"],img[src$="folder_editor_buttons/b.png"],img[src$="folder_editor_buttons/bb_help.png"],img[src$="folder_editor_buttons/center.png"],img[src$="folder_editor_buttons/clear.png"],img[src$="folder_editor_buttons/code.png"],img[src$="folder_editor_buttons/hide.png"],img[src$="folder_editor_buttons/i.png"],img[src$="folder_editor_buttons/left.png"],img[src$="folder_editor_buttons/list.png"],img[src$="folder_editor_buttons/numlist.png"],img[src$="folder_editor_buttons/offtop.png"],img[src$="folder_editor_buttons/quote.png"],img[src$="folder_editor_buttons/right.png"],img[src$="folder_editor_buttons/s.png"],img[src$="folder_editor_buttons/spoil.png"],img[src$="folder_editor_buttons/spoiler.png"],img[src$="folder_editor_buttons/sub.png"],img[src$="folder_editor_buttons/sup.png"],img[src$="folder_editor_buttons/u.png"],img[src$="folder_editor_buttons/url.png"]{transition:var(--tran);border:0!important;background-color:var(--accent-dim);padding-top:3em;padding-left:3em;width:0!important;height:0!important}img[src$="folder_editor_buttons/area_minus.png"]:hover,img[src$="folder_editor_buttons/area_plus.png"]:hover,img[src$="folder_editor_buttons/b.png"]:hover,img[src$="folder_editor_buttons/bb_help.png"]:hover,img[src$="folder_editor_buttons/center.png"]:hover,img[src$="folder_editor_buttons/clear.png"]:hover,img[src$="folder_editor_buttons/code.png"]:hover,img[src$="folder_editor_buttons/hide.png"]:hover,img[src$="folder_editor_buttons/i.png"]:hover,img[src$="folder_editor_buttons/left.png"]:hover,img[src$="folder_editor_buttons/list.png"]:hover,img[src$="folder_editor_buttons/numlist.png"]:hover,img[src$="folder_editor_buttons/offtop.png"]:hover,img[src$="folder_editor_buttons/quote.png"]:hover,img[src$="folder_editor_buttons/right.png"]:hover,img[src$="folder_editor_buttons/s.png"]:hover,img[src$="folder_editor_buttons/spoil.png"]:hover,img[src$="folder_editor_buttons/spoiler.png"]:hover,img[src$="folder_editor_buttons/sub.png"]:hover,img[src$="folder_editor_buttons/sup.png"]:hover,img[src$="folder_editor_buttons/u.png"]:hover,img[src$="folder_editor_buttons/url.png"]:hover{background-color:var(--fg-accent-d)}img[src$="folder_editor_buttons/b.png"]{-webkit-m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M14 10V7c0-1-1-2-2-2H6v12h8c1 0 2-1 2-2v-3c0-1-1-2-2-2zM8 7h3c.5 0 1 .5 1 1v1c0 .5-.5 1-1 1H8zm5 8H8v-3h5c.5 0 1 .5 1 1v1c0 .5-.5 1-1 1z'/%3E%3C/svg%3E");m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M14 10V7c0-1-1-2-2-2H6v12h8c1 0 2-1 2-2v-3c0-1-1-2-2-2zM8 7h3c.5 0 1 .5 1 1v1c0 .5-.5 1-1 1H8zm5 8H8v-3h5c.5 0 1 .5 1 1v1c0 .5-.5 1-1 1z'/%3E%3C/svg%3E")}img[src$="folder_editor_buttons/i.png"]{-webkit-m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M12 5L8 17h2l4-12z'/%3E%3C/svg%3E");m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M12 5L8 17h2l4-12z'/%3E%3C/svg%3E")}img[src$="folder_editor_buttons/u.png"]{-webkit-m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M6 5v7c0 3 2 5 5 5s5-2 5-5V5h-2v7c0 2-1 3-3 3s-3-1-3-3V5zM5 18v1h12v-1z'/%3E%3C/svg%3E");m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M6 5v7c0 3 2 5 5 5s5-2 5-5V5h-2v7c0 2-1 3-3 3s-3-1-3-3V5zM5 18v1h12v-1z'/%3E%3C/svg%3E")}img[src$="folder_editor_buttons/s.png"]{-webkit-m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M15 5H6v5h2V7h5v1h2V5zM5 11v1h12v-1H5zm9 2v2H9v-1H7v3h9v-4h-2z'/%3E%3C/svg%3E");m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M15 5H6v5h2V7h5v1h2V5zM5 11v1h12v-1H5zm9 2v2H9v-1H7v3h9v-4h-2z'/%3E%3C/svg%3E")}img[src$="folder_editor_buttons/sub.png"]{-webkit-m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M5 5l3 5-3 5h2.5l2-3.5 2 3.5H14l-3-5 3-5h-2.5l-2 3.5-2-3.5zm12 10v-4h-2.5v1H16v2h-1.5v3H17v-1h-1.5v-1z'/%3E%3C/svg%3E");m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M5 5l3 5-3 5h2.5l2-3.5 2 3.5H14l-3-5 3-5h-2.5l-2 3.5-2-3.5zm12 10v-4h-2.5v1H16v2h-1.5v3H17v-1h-1.5v-1z'/%3E%3C/svg%3E")}img[src$="folder_editor_buttons/sup.png"]{-webkit-m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 22 22'%3E%3Cpath d='M5 7l3 5-3 5h2.5l2-3.5 2 3.5H14l-3-5 3-5h-2.5l-2 3.5-2-3.5zm12 2V5h-2.5v1H16v2h-1.5v3H17v-1h-1.5V9z'/%3E%3C/svg%3E");mask-image:url("data:image/svg+xml;charset=utf-8,%3Csvg xmlns='http://www.w3.org...

Reviews

No reviews yet.